Viral Cookie Tin – Chocolate Chip Cookies

Recipe by Swad Institute

  • Ready in30 min
  • Prep10 min
  • Cook20 min
  • CuisineDessert · American
  • Serves8-9 Cookies
  • Calories~380 kcal
Viral Cookie Tin – Chocolate Chip Cookies

Ingredients

Main Ingredients

  • 90gmButter
  • 180gmBrown Sugar
  • 60gmMilk
  • 5gmVanilla
  • 110gmFlour
  • 5gmBaking Soda
  • 200gmDark Chocolate
  • 1/4 tspSea Salt
  • 20gmChoco Chips

Step-by-Step Instructions

  1. 1.Prepare the Dough Base

    Add 90gm of butter and 180gm of brown sugar to a mixing bowl. Use an electric mixer to combine them until fully incorporated and a smooth, creamy mixture is formed.

  2. 2.Add Wet Ingredients

    Pour in 60gm of milk and 5gm of vanilla extract into the butter and sugar mixture. Whisk thoroughly until all ingredients are well combined and the mixture is smooth.

  3. 3.Incorporate Dry Ingredients

    Add 110gm of flour and 5gm of baking soda to the wet mixture. Mix with a spatula until a smooth, cohesive dough forms.

  4. 4.Form Chocolate-Filled Cookies

    Take a portion of the dough, flatten it in your palm, and place a piece of dark chocolate in the center. Carefully fold the dough around the chocolate and roll it into a smooth ball, ensuring the chocolate is completely enclosed. Each dough ball should be approximately 30gm.

  5. 5.Assemble in Tin

    Grease a round baking tin and arrange the chocolate-filled cookie dough balls inside, pressing them gently to fill the tin. Sprinkle 1/4 teaspoon of sea salt evenly over the dough balls. Add more dough balls if needed to fill any gaps.

  6. 6.Add Topping

    Sprinkle 20gm of choco chips over the top of the cookie dough in the tin.

  7. 7.Bake the Cookie Tin

    Preheat your oven to 160°C. Place the cookie tin in the oven and bake for 18 to 20 minutes, or until the cookies are golden brown and cooked through.

  8. 8.Serve Warm

    Carefully remove the baked cookie tin from the oven using oven mitts. Allow it to cool slightly before serving warm, revealing the gooey melted chocolate inside.
